The South Wales Derby
One of the most heated rivalries in Welsh football is undoubtedly the South Wales Derby between Cardiff City FC and Swansea City AFC. This rivalry transcends mere sporting competition; it represents historical, cultural, and social divides between the two cities.
The matches are marked by intense atmosphere, passionate chants, and fierce competition, often bringing the regions of Cardiff and Swansea to a standstill. The significance of the derby goes beyond the points on the table; it’s a matter of pride for the respective fan bases.
Historically, encounters between the two clubs have produced memorable moments, from stunning goals to last-minute winners. The emotions run high as fans eagerly anticipate these clashes, knowing that bragging rights are at stake for the next few months. The intensity of the South Wales Derby showcases the deep-rooted connections that football has with the communities it represents.

Memorable Matches in Cardiff City FC’s History
Throughout its history, Cardiff City FC has been involved in several memorable matches that have left an indelible mark on its fans. These encounters epitomize the highs and lows of being a supporter, complete with dramatic twists and turns.
One such match occurred during the FA Cup final in 1927, where Cardiff City faced off against Arsenal. The thrill of seeing Cardiff emerge victorious established the club as trailblazers, marking a momentous occasion in Welsh football history.
More recently, Cardiff’s promotion to the Premier League in 2013 was celebrated with euphoric matches that showcased the team’s talent and determination. The excitement of facing some of the best teams in the world invigorated supporters, strengthening their bond with Cardiff City FC.
